Our under-23s slipped to another defeat on Saturday as they were beaten 4-0 by Liverpool. Coming into this game, only a point separated the two sides - but the hosts were full of confidence after a dramatic 3-2 victory over Chelsea just one week earlier. We started on the front foot, though, and looked dangerous in transition with Reiss Nelson breaking forward at pace and squaring for Nikolaj Moller, who was unable to make contact at the final moment. Liverpool had barely had a sight of our goal but, with a lapse in concentration from Ryan Alebiosu, we gifted possession away inside the area and Layton Stewart duly found the bottom corner. ....
WHAT HAPPENED Our under-18s suffered a disappointing 3-0 defeat to West Brom in the U-18 Premier League South on Saturday. Khayon Edwards returned in attack for Ken Gillard’s side - but we were unable to break down a resilient Baggies outfit. The visitors came into this fixture boasting the second best away record in the division, and they made it count early on as Mo Faal converted Tom Fellows’ delivery with a thumping header. Omari Hutchinson then fired over the bar from the edge of the area, before Henry Jeffcott combined with Nathan Butley-Oyedeji and found himself through on goal, only to lose composure and fire over. ....
